rclone在虚拟服务器上的高效备份方案
卡尔云官网
www.kaeryun.com
随着虚拟服务器的普及,数据备份已成为网络管理员和VPS主机者不可忽视的重要任务,rclone是一款开源的文件系统克隆工具,它能够快速、安全地备份数据,是虚拟服务器环境中常用的备份解决方案,本文将详细介绍如何利用rclone在虚拟服务器上进行高效的数据备份。
rclone简介
rclone是一款基于Linux的开源克隆工具,主要用于克隆文件系统,它能够创建完整的克隆,包括目录结构、文件属性和内容,与传统的文件备份工具不同,rclone的优势在于其高效性和安全性,它能够在短时间内完成克隆过程,并且支持远程备份,适合虚拟服务器的使用。
rclone在虚拟服务器上的配置
要利用rclone进行备份,首先需要在虚拟服务器上安装rclone,安装完成后,可以按照以下步骤配置:
-
安装rclone
在虚拟服务器的控制面板中,通过包管理器安装rclone,通常可以通过以下命令安装:sudo apt-get install rclone
-
设置rclone配置文件
rclone的配置文件通常位于/etc/rclone/config
,用户可以根据需要修改配置,但默认配置已经能满足大多数需求。 -
验证配置
在配置文件中,可以添加一些测试命令,确保rclone能够正常工作。rclone --version
rclone备份策略
在虚拟服务器上,备份策略是关键,以下是几种常见的备份策略:
-
全盘备份
全盘备份是rclone默认的备份方式,它会克隆整个虚拟服务器的文件系统,包括操作系统文件、配置文件和所有用户数据,虽然备份范围广,但备份时间较长。 -
目录结构备份
目录结构备份只克隆指定目录下的文件和子目录,这种方式适合备份大型网站或应用,可以显著减少备份时间。 -
增量备份
增量备份仅备份最近的修改文件,这种方式非常高效,适合频繁更新的文件。 -
日志备份
rclone支持备份日志文件,日志备份可以记录系统状态和错误日志,有助于快速定位问题。
rclone的安全性
rclone的安全性是备份过程中必须考虑的方面,以下是几个提高备份安全性的好方法:
-
使用加密
rclone支持加密克隆结果,使用加密可以防止备份文件被恶意解码或篡改。 -
设置访问控制
在备份完成后,可以设置访问控制,限制外人或内部员工访问备份文件。 -
定期检查备份文件
定期检查备份文件的完整性,确保备份没有出错。
rclone的优化
为了最大化rclone的性能,可以进行一些优化:
-
设置日志
通过设置rclone的日志,可以更好地监控备份过程。 -
自动备份
配置rclone进行自动备份,可以避免手动操作带来的错误。 -
监控备份状态
使用监控工具,实时查看备份的进度和状态。
常见问题
-
备份失败怎么办?
如果备份失败,可以检查日志,查看是否有错误信息,如果找不到问题,可以尝试手动克隆。 -
备份时间过长怎么办?
如果备份时间过长,可以尝试减少备份范围,或者增加磁盘空间。 -
备份文件太多怎么办?
针对备份文件过多的问题,可以设置文件大小限制,或者删除旧的备份文件。
rclone是一款功能强大且灵活的备份工具,特别适合虚拟服务器环境,通过合理的配置和优化,可以利用rclone进行高效、安全的数据备份,无论是全盘备份还是目录结构备份,rclone都能满足不同需求,注意备份的安全性和优化,可以确保备份过程顺利进行。
卡尔云官网
www.kaeryun.com